- package org.jboss.as.ejb3.timer.schedule;
- import junit.framework.Assert;
- import org.jboss.as.ejb3.timerservice.schedule.value.RangeValue;
- import org.junit.Test;
- /**
- * RangeValueTestCase
- *
- * @author Jaikiran Pai
- * @version $Revision: $
- */
- public class RangeValueTestCase {
- @Test
- public void testInvalidRange() {
- String[] invalidRangeValues =
- {null, "", " ", "0.1", "1d", "1.0", "?", "%", "$", "!", "&", "-", "/", ",", ".", "1-", "1-2-3", "1+2", "**",
- "*-", "*,1", "1,*", "5/*", "1, 2/2", "---", "-", "--", " -2 -3 -4", "-0", "1--"};
- for (String invalidRange : invalidRangeValues) {
- boolean accepts = RangeValue.accepts(invalidRange);
- Assert.assertFalse("Range value accepted an invalid value: " + invalidRange, accepts);
- try {
- RangeValue invalidRangeValue = new RangeValue(invalidRange);
- Assert.fail("Range value did *not* throw IllegalArgumentException for an invalid range: " + invalidRange);
- } catch (IllegalArgumentException iae) {
- // expected
- }
- }
- }
- @Test
- public void testValidRange() {
- String[] validRanges =
- {"1-8", "-7--1", "7--1", "1st Fri-1st Mon"};
- for (String validRange : validRanges) {
- boolean accepts = RangeValue.accepts(validRange);
- Assert.assertTrue("Valid range value wasn't accepted: " + validRange, accepts);
- RangeValue validRangeValue = new RangeValue(validRange);
- }
- }
- }
